Trace Sensing Technologies
Develops breath-based diagnostic technology using ultra-sensitive vapor sensors to detect proteomic and volatile organic compound (VOC) biomarkers in exhaled breath. The company designs compact desktop diagnostic devices and accompanying software, conducts biomarker discovery and validation studies across cardiometabolic, neurodegenerative, oncology and infectious disease areas, and maintains a patent portfolio for its sensor technology. It is pursuing regulatory authorization and clinical pilots to enable point-of-care deployment.

Products
Desktop breath-analysis diagnostic device
A compact desktop device that analyzes exhaled breath using configurable sensor modules and catalyst-coated vapor sensors to detect biomarkers and deliver rapid test results.

Services
Biomarker discovery and validation partnerships
Collaborative studies with academic and clinical partners to discover and validate breath biomarkers across disease indications.
Pilot study and clinical evaluation support
Operational support and device access for pilot studies evaluating breath-based diagnostics in target populations (examples: CKD, ADRD, cancer, infectious disease).
